15/*
16 * Object performing an offline EMCAL trigger decision based on user defined criterions
17 * (trigger patch type, energy threshold,...). The main method MakeTriggerDecision performs
18 * an event selection and creates a trigger decision object with the relevant information.
19 *
20 * Author: Markus Fasel
21 */

57//______________________________________________________________________________
58AliEmcalTriggerDecision* AliEmcalTriggerSelection::MakeDecison(const TClonesArray * const inputPatches) const {
59 /*
60 * Perform event selection based on user-defined criteria and create an output trigger decision containing
61 * the threshold, the main patch which fired the decision, and all other patches which would have fired the
62 * decision as well.
63 *
64 * @param input patches: A list of input patches, created by the trigger patch maker and read out from the
65 * input event
66 * @return: the trigger decision (an event is selected when it has a main patch that fired the decision)
67 */
68 AliEmcalTriggerDecision *result = new AliEmcalTriggerDecision(fOutputName.Data());
69 TIter patchIter(inputPatches);
70 AliEmcalTriggerPatchInfo *patch(NULL);
71 std::vector<AliEmcalTriggerPatchInfo *> selectedPatches;
72 while((patch = dynamic_cast<AliEmcalTriggerPatchInfo *>(patchIter()))){
73 if(fSelectionCuts->IsSelected(patch)){
74 selectedPatches.push_back(patch);
75 }
76 }
77 // Find the main patch
78 AliEmcalTriggerPatchInfo *mainPatch(NULL), *testpatch(NULL);
79 for(std::vector<AliEmcalTriggerPatchInfo *>::iterator it = selectedPatches.begin(); it != selectedPatches.end(); ++it){
80 testpatch = *it;
81 if(!mainPatch) mainPatch = testpatch;
82 else if(fSelectionCuts->CompareTriggerPatches(testpatch, mainPatch) > 0) mainPatch = testpatch;
83 result->AddAcceptedPatch(testpatch);
84 }
85 if(mainPatch) result->SetMainPatch(mainPatch);
86 result->SetSelectionCuts(fSelectionCuts);
87 return result;
88}
